Job Purpose ICE Clear Europe’s Clearing Risk Department (“CRD”) is looking for a front office risk director. The successful candidate will work closely with the senior management in overseeing and shaping the risk management practice at one of the largest futures and options clearing houses in the world. You will be joining a very dynamic team, be exposed to a wide range of asset classes and be challenged with complex risk problems. You will be responsible for managing all aspects of the day-to-day risk management and drive improvement and enhancements, including identifying, developing and overseeing the implementation of new risk management tools and techniques to enhance the risk management process and risk controls. You will also contribute towards the design and implementation of new risk initiatives and products that benefit the business. Responsibilities Identify areas where the risk models, risk management processes, or infrastructure can be improved Assist with designing and implementing improvement and enhancements to models, risk infrastructure, and processes. Act as the project lead in seeing it through completion Frequent communication with representatives from clearing members, risk committees and senior management of ICE Strike the right balance between complying with global regulatory standards and achieving commercial business requirements Ensure the risk management framework and risk policies are being adhered to and are consistent with regulatory and industry standards Monitor model performance tests and assess the appropriateness of models in order to demonstrate policy adherence Conduct mathematical/statistical analysis to calibrate and enhance risk models Collaborate with colleagues on key policy and methodology development Documentation of risk policies and models to clearing members, regulators, risk committees and other governance bodies Conduct project work and run thematic or ad-hoc market research on relevant risk topics Lead a team of risk analysts and managers to foster a strong risk culture Knowledge and Experience Master’s Degree in Mathematical Finance or equivalent degree Attention to detail and strong problem-solving skills with the ability to balance trade-offs Must have demonstrable experience in a role of the same or equivalent level and/or relevant professional experience in risk management and/or risk systems.
